North Carolina's weather, characterized by significant humidity and occasional extreme temperatures, can affect garage door hardware. Moisture can lead to corrosion on metal lock components, causing them to seize or become difficult to operate. Conversely, sudden temperature drops can make materials contract, potentially affecting the alignment of the lock and its strike plate, leading to sticking or failure to engage. We inspect these elements as part of our lock repair process.

How do I know if my garage door lock needs professional attention?

If your key won't turn, the lock feels stiff, or the door won't open or close completely when the lock is engaged, it's time for professional assessment. Issues like these can indicate internal mechanism problems or misalignment. Ignoring them can lead to further damage or security vulnerabilities.

What's the difference between a standard lock and a garage door lock?

Garage door locks are specifically designed to withstand the weight and movement of a large door and are often integrated with the opener system. Standard household locks are not built for these demands. Proper function of a garage door lock is crucial for both security and the smooth operation of the door itself.
